does anyone know if you were to weigh-in on surgery below the BMI that you got approved with, if insurance will deny the surgery?
When I started this process, I was 252 at 5'5, just barely qualifying with a 41.7 BMI. I am waiting on my surgery date (pre-op nutrition class is tomorrow) and I just weighed myself and I am at 245.7 which is a BMI of 40.9. I'm worried that if I drop too low before surgery, that when the surgery is actually submitted to insurance-it will be denied. I was approved already, but anyone else go through this or do they just use your starting weight?
